One of the standout features of homes in Springfield is the availability of corner lot properties. These homes offer not only increased privacy but also expansive outdoor spaces that are perfect for gardening, entertaining, or simply enjoying the fresh air. Corner lots often provide additional parking, making it easier for you and your guests to come and go without the hassle of street congestion.
